- What's an Overload relay !? Thermal/Magnetic overload relay is a sensory device works with a contactor that protects a motor from Continuous high current draw and will allow a non-dangerous temporary overload such as a high current flow condition during starting.However, it will turn off the motor if a current is high enough to cause motor damage over time.
